Use the designated immersion point

Many gram panchayats and municipalities set aside a pond or a marked stretch of tank for immersion. Ask at the panchayat office — it changes year to year, and a drinking-water tank or a farm pond is not an alternative.

Unpainted clay dissolves, plaster of Paris does not

A clay idol breaks down in water within hours. Plaster of Paris does not, and the paints carry heavy metals, so idols accumulate in tanks and rivers after immersion. Pollution control boards in most states now ask for clay for exactly this reason.

Someone should be watching the water, not the idol

Immersion points get crowded and the bank is slippery after the monsoon. Children go into the water at these gatherings every year. Keep one person watching the water rather than the procession.

Take the accessories home

Thermocol, plastic sheeting, cloth and metal ornaments do not belong in the tank even when the idol itself is clay. Most organised immersion points now have a collection bin at the bank for them.

Phulowala Dod (224) at a glance

Phulowala Dod (224) is a village of 1,261 people in 236 households (Census 2011) in Budhlada tehsil, Mansa district, Punjab, the 65th-largest of 87 villages in Budhlada tehsil. Literacy is 51%, about the same as the tehsil average of 51% and the sex ratio is 911 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 151502, served by Budhlada post office; the LGD village code is 36045. The sarpanch is Maninder Singh, and the village votes in Budhlada assembly constituency, represented by MLA Budh Ram. The population is estimated at 1,487 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
